Transaction ed01e7c82099d385690421d12515ea170366f7f23e080b3cb995b30cd557f093
1 Input
1 Output
-
ed01e7c82099d385690421d12515ea170366f7f23e080b3cb995b30cd557f093:0
- value
- 6331337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 006b57c49dc6a5b86ead85fa19c739f9b4cb97bd OP_EQUAL
- address
- 31jEWrZUpqkf7buJEnpFCvBU9JdDHfVMRE